> In the JEE Environment a second datasource must be specified to create the 
> OpenJPA sequence table

> The openjpa manual states clearly that a second unmanaged DataSource is 
> required for updating sequence table (page 205: 4.2.1. Managed and XA 
> DataSources): 
> "When using a managed DataSource, you should also configure a second 
> unmanaged DataSource that OpenJPA can use to perform tasks that are 
> independent of the global transaction. The most common of these tasks is 
> updating the sequence table OpenJPA uses to generate unique primary key 
> values for your datastore identity objects. Configure the second DataSource 
> using the non-jta-data-source persistence.xml element, or OpenJPA's various 
> "2" connection properties, such as openjpa.ConnectionFactory2Name or 
> openjpa.Connection2DriverName. These properties are outlined in
> Chapter 2, Configuration [161]."
> Openjpa, however, does not this rule when Sequence table is involved. As a 
> result, the application hangs when only one datasource is configured. This is 
> not very user-friendly. An error message should be thrown when this situation 
> is detected.
